Heard of Skin Brushing ? It is a great way to revitalize the skin and helps to promote lymphatic cleansing. It will remove the top layer of dead skin to stimulate circulation and deeply cleanse the pores. Skin Brushing iss also known to help reduce/remove cellulite. The Tampico Skin Brush ($9.95 Amazon) is the best out there because it is an all-natural vegetable fiber brush and also has a long handle to aide in reaching the back and entire body. For best results brush on dry skin in the direction towards your heart right before you shower/bathe.
